You don't need a high pressure fuel pump and regulator to help fuel surge, you need lots of fuel in the tank or a swirl pot/surge tank.


The problem is the positioning of the fuel pickup in the tank - out the hairpin the fuel is mainly sitting in the opposite side of the tank to the pickup which runs the pump dry.

A fuel pressure gauge will tell you it is happening a short while before the car complains majorly. You can get a little bit of detonation from this so it is worth avoiding repeatedly over many track days.

Some uprated fuel pumps can even make the situation worse if you use the supplied pick up that comes with them which is sometimes shorter.

How much fuel did you have when it was surging?

Tony, my JDM STi still gets fuel pick up problems - so it's not just UK models. You'll just need to try harder.
Anyway I take extra fuel with me and top up when the tank gets to 1/4 left.
